文章详情页
mysql优化 - mysql like语句会导致全表扫描?
浏览:54日期:2022-06-12 10:38:44
问题描述
select id from t where name like ’%abc%’
问题解答
回答1:模糊查询,就算你有索引,你也不知道索引里是不是有这三个字母还是这么排列的位置还是这样的那一行呀。。。
回答2:不一定 看查询条件。如果是符合左前缀,即可走索引比如 like abc%
回答3:同楼上,sql中尽量别 like 前后模糊,如果数据量大,那得蹦。
相关文章:
1. vue打包和PHP后台怎样同域名部署配置2. php怎么实现删除文章的同时,同时删除编辑器上传的图片??3. 请问老师?4. dump(Db::query(’SELECT * FROM `user`’));的时候提醒错误。5. 数组排序,并把排序后的值存入到新数组中6. 请问“由于 Cookie “PHPSESSID”的“SameSite”属性设置为“None”,但缺少“Secure”属性,此 Cookie 未来将被拒绝。”请问出现这个问题怎么办?7. 07:08秒,老师讲错了8. php多任务倒计时求助9. 上传多图时,最后一张图为缩略图,想设置第一张图为缩略图怎么解决?10. 请问连接文件怎么写
排行榜
